What is Jomac?
JOMAC specializes in manufacturing custom aluminum truck bodies and cranes, offering a wide range of products including utility bodies, mechanics truck bodies, and various types of cranes. Their products are designed to meet the specific needs of clients in industries such as service, utility, and emergency response. With a focus on lightweight and durable aluminum construction, JOMAC ensures that their truck bodies are rust-free for life and optimized for fuel efficiency. The company prides itself on handcrafting each product at their facility in Carrollton, Ohio, providing personalized solutions for their customers.
